Restaurant, Bar, 24-Hour Front Desk, Newspapers, Rooms/Facilities for Disabled Guests, Elevator, Safety Deposit Box, Luggage Storage, All Public and Private spaces non-smoking.
Fitness Centre.
Room Service, Meeting/Banquet Facilities, Business Centre, Laundry, Dry Cleaning.
Wireless Internet Hotspot is available in public areas and charges are applicable.
Wireless Internet Hotspot is available in some hotel rooms and charges are applicable.
Internet via TV is available in the hotel rooms and costs GBP 8.00 per 24 hours.
Private parking is possible on site and costs GBP 5.00 per day.
From 14:00 hours
Until 12:00 hours
If cancelled up to 14:00 on the date of arrival, no fee will be charged.
If cancelled later or in case of no-show, the first night will be charged.
All children under 10 years stay free of charge when using existing bedding.
All children under 2 years stay free of charge for cots.
All older children or adults stay free of charge for extra beds.
Maximum capacity of extra beds/babycots in a room is 1.
Any extra bedding is upon request and needs to be confirmed by the hotel.
Pets are not allowed.
